Members Soapsuds Posted January 14, 2008 Members Share Posted January 14, 2008 Numbers are based on Live+Same Day ratings December 31, 2007 - January 4, 2008 (Compared to Last Week/Compared to Last Year) Total Viewers 1. Y&R 5,713,000 (-39,000/-188,000) 2. B&B 4,030,000 (+154,000/-113,000) 3. ATWT 3,232,000 (+170,000/-11,000) 4. DAYS 3,102,000 (+152,000/-255,000) 5. GH 3,045,000 (+8,000/-324,000) 6. OLTL 2,710,000 (-49,000/-315,000) 7. AMC 2,693,000 (-142,000/-433,000) 8. GL 2,644,000 (+61,000/-169,000) HH 1. Y&R 4.1/12 (-.1/-.4) 2. B&B 2.9/9 (same/-.3) 3. ATWT 2.4/7 (+.1/-.1) 4. DAYS 2.3/7 (+.2/-.4) 4. GH 2.3/7 (-.1/-.4) 6. AMC 2.1/6 (same/-.4) 6. OLTL 2.1/6 (same/-.3) 8. GL 1.9/5 (same/-.2) Women 18-49 Viewers 1. Y&R 1,342,000 (+38,000/-72,000) 2. B&B 1,021,000 (+145,000/+13,000) 3. GH 997,000 (-23,000/-192,000) 4. DAYS 976,000 (+65,000/-254,000) 5. ATWT 967,000 (+175,000/+83,000) 6. OLTL 880,000 (-13,000/-131,000) 7. GL 838,000 (+98,000/-2,000) 8. AMC 788,000 (-52,000/-212,000) Women 18-49 Rating 1. Y&R 2.0/12 (same/-.2) 2. B&B 1.5/9 (+.2/same) 2. DAYS 1.5/8 (+.1/-.4) 2. ATWT 1.5/8 (+.3/+.2) 2. GH 1.5/8 (same/-.3) 6. OLTL 1.3/8 (-.1/-.2) 6. GL 1.3/7 (+.2/same) 8. AMC 1.2/7 (-.1/-.3) Girls 12-17 Viewers 1. DAYS 82,000 (-34,000/+19,000) 2. GH 59,000 (-7,000/-7,000) 3. OLTL 52,000 (-8,000/+13,000) 4. B&B 45,000 (+6,000/-6,000) 5. GL 43,000 (+12,000/-6,000) 6. Y&R 34,000 (-30,000/-45,000) 7. ATWT 28,000 (-9,000/-24,000) 8. AMC 15,000 (-35,000/-21,000) Women 18-34 Rating 1. DAYS 1.3/8 (+.4/-.4) 1. Y&R 1.3/8 (same/-.1) 3. GH 1.0/5 (same/-.4) 4. OLTL 0.9/5 (same/-.3) 5. ATWT 0.8/5 (same/-.1) 5. B&B 0.8/5 (same/-.2) 5. AMC 0.8/5 (-.2/-.2) 8. GL 0.6/3 (-.1/-.2) Men 18+ Viewers 1. Y&R 1,464,000 (+81,000/-91,000) 2. B&B 969,000 (+77,000/+21,000) 3. DAYS 711,000 (+55,000/+94,000) 4. ATWT 696,000 (+16,000/+2,000) 5. GH 551,000 (-24,000/-25,000) 6. AMC 533,000 (-145,000/-59,000) 7. GL 509,000 (-51,000/-106,000) 8. OLTL 470,000 (-100,000/-79,000) ------------------------------------- Day-To-Day Ratings - HH/Total Viewers AMC Monday: 2.2/2,882,000 (did not count) Tuesday: Wednesday: 2.2/2,634,000 Thursday: 2.2/2,817,000 Friday: 2.0/2,627,000 ATWT Monday: Tuesday: Wednesday: 2.6/3,469,000 Thursday: 2.4/3,059,000 Friday: 2.4/3,168,000 B&B Monday: 2.2/3,103,000 (did not count) Tuesday: Wednesday: 3.1/4,350,000 Thursday: 3.0/3,962,000 Friday: 2.7/3,778,000 DAYS Monday: 2.2/2,988,000 (did not count) Tuesday: Wednesday: 2.3/3,161,000 Thursday: 2.3/3,130,000 Friday: 2.2/3,013,000 GH Monday: 2.3/2,967,000 (did not count) Tuesday: Wednesday: 2.4/3,078,000 Thursday: 2.4/3,118,000 Friday: 2.2/2,938,000 GL Monday: Tuesday: Wednesday: 2.0/2,746,000 Thursday: 2.0/2,575,000 Friday: 1.9/2,609,000 OLTL Monday: 2.0/2,633,000 Tuesday: Wednesday: 2.2/2,870,000 Thursday: 2.2/2,749,000 Friday: 2.0/2,511,000 Y&R Monday: Tuesday: Wednesday: 4.3/6,281,000 Thursday: 4.0/5,325,000 Friday: 4.0/5,534,000 ---------------------- For the SEASON September 24, 2007 through January 6, 2008 HH 1. Y&R 4.1 2. B&B 2.9 3. GH 2.4 4. ATWT 2.3 5. OLTL 2.2 6. AMC 2.1 6. DAYS 2.1 8. GL 1.9 Women 18-49 Rating 1. Y&R 1.9 2. GH 1.6 3. OLTL 1.4 3. B&B 1.4 3. DAYS 1.4 6. ATWT 1.3 7. AMC 1.2 8. GL 1.1 --------------------------------------------------------------------------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
